  4. Bella Says:

    I’ve done both, and both are really fun! I think swing lessons made me laugh more, and I was looser at them and more playful. Salsa seemed a bit harder, so I guess in the beginning I concentrated more than I had fun.

    As for which is funner/more useful in the long run I’d say salsa. It’s a more sensual, sexy dance and you will probably find more occasions to dance it at parties and stuff. Not as many songs have a swing-ish beat to them.

  8. Gorme Says:

    Swing is alot easier to learn and to look decent when dancing socially. Salsa takes more time to learn and to really be able to move your body to the music. There are also alot more salsa clubs out there than swing clubs.

    I’d say learn a little bit of swing to get used to just dancing in general. Then move on to Salsa.
